2. Fundamental Concepts of Probability and Expected Value
a. Basic probability principles in gaming contexts
Probability quantifies the likelihood of specific outcomes, calculated as the ratio of favorable cases to total possible cases. For example, in a game where a six-sided die is rolled, the probability of rolling a 4 is 1/6.
b. Expected value: how it predicts average outcomes over time
Expected value (EV) represents the average return a player can anticipate over many repetitions. It is calculated by summing each possible outcome multiplied by its probability. A positive EV indicates a favorable game, while a negative EV suggests a long-term loss expectation.

3. The Concept of Multipliers in Probability Games
a. What are multipliers and how do they function within game rules
Multipliers are game mechanics that increase the payout of a winning outcome by a specific factor, such as 2x or 5x. They are integrated into game rules, often triggered by specific events or random features, effectively amplifying winnings without altering the underlying probability of winning.
b. Historical evolution and modern implementation of multipliers
Originally used in physical slot machines, multipliers have evolved into complex digital features. Modern implementations include random multipliers, fixed multipliers, or progressive multipliers that increase during gameplay, making outcomes more unpredictable and engaging.
c. Examples of multipliers across different game genres
- Slot Machines: Multipliers appear randomly during spins, often doubling or tripling payouts.
- Video Poker: Some variants offer multiplier bonuses for specific hands.
- Table Games: Certain blackjack variants include multiplier side bets.
4. How Multipliers Influence Game Outcomes and Player Experience
a. Increasing potential winnings and variability
Multipliers significantly boost the variance of outcomes, allowing players to achieve large payouts from relatively modest wins. This heightened variability enhances the thrill of the game, as players anticipate the possibility of hitting big multipliers.
b. Psychological effects: excitement, engagement, and risk perception
The prospect of multipliers fosters excitement and engagement by creating moments of anticipation. However, they also elevate perceived risk, as players may overestimate their chances of hitting high multipliers, influencing betting behavior.
c. Balancing game fairness with thrill factors
While multipliers add excitement, they must be balanced with fairness measures such as RNG certification and transparent RTP (Return to Player) percentages to maintain trust and compliance with regulatory standards.
